When communication overload gets too extreme an employee might begin to miss a lot of work or even resign. This method of handling communication overload is known as:
 
  a. omission
 b. queuing
 c. escape
 d. redundancy

Question 2

Dealing with communication overload by prioritizing which information should be dealt with first refers to:
 
  a. omission
 b. escape
 c. queuing
 d. omnibus processing
